Major Companies and Sources of Wealth
Coal, Energy, and Natural Gas Empires
Historically, the wealthiest West Virginia fortunes were built on coal mining and related energy operations. Families who controlled major coal companies and related supply chains accumulated generational wealth that still influences the state's economy. Today, some of these dynasties have diversified into natural gas, utilities, and clean energy investments Forbes.

How Net Worth Is Measured and Ranked
Forbes and other trackers estimate net worth by valuing public and private holdings, subtracting debt, and updating figures as markets move. Rankings can shift quickly based on stock prices, asset sales, and new investments, making the latest data essential for understanding current wealth concentration in West Virginia Forbes billionaires list.
